Focusing on the female pantheon of Yoruba mythology, this volume explores the journeys of seven goddesses, including Oxum and Yemanjá. It delves into themes of heroism, narrative forms, and the interplay between myth and science. Each goddess's story serves as a vehicle for personal growth and transcendence, offering readers insights into their own lives. The narrative emphasizes Oxum's evolution from gallant love to constructive love, providing a deeper understanding of love and personal development through mythological lenses.
